Western diplomatic circles indicate that U.S. pressure on Israel, along with U.S. Ambassador to Lebanon Michel Aoun's visit to Tel Aviv, has accelerated Lebanese-Israeli negotiations regarding prisoners and the missing. The eighth round is scheduled to take place after the Jewish New Year holiday on September 11, with the political and military delegations proceeding separately in the negotiation process. It is expected that the political delegation will meet in Rome or Jordan on the 14th and 15th of this month, while the military meeting will be held in Tampa, Florida. Sources reported that Israel released some non-combatant prisoners from Hezbollah as a goodwill gesture in exchange for providing Lebanon with information about approximately 80 Jews and details concerning the remains of one of the soldiers. Aisa's visit contributed to speeding up the scheduling of this new round, especially after Netanyahu's refusal to hand over Talat al-Tahir, which caused delays in the negotiation process.
